GraniteShares YieldBOOST Semiconductor ETF (NASDAQ:SEMY) Short Interest Down 52.3% in June

GraniteShares YieldBOOST Semiconductor ETF (NASDAQ:SEMYGet Free Report) was the target of a large decrease in short interest during the month of June. As of June 15th, there was short interest totaling 4,153 shares, a decrease of 52.3% from the May 31st total of 8,703 shares. Currently, 0.1% of the shares of the stock are sold short. Based on an average daily volume of 206,595 shares, the short-interest ratio is presently 0.0 days.

GraniteShares YieldBOOST Semiconductor ETF is an exchange-traded fund designed to provide investors with exposure to the semiconductor industry while pursuing an income-oriented options strategy. The fund is part of GraniteShares’ suite of thematic and income-focused ETFs, and it seeks to combine participation in the semiconductor sector with an enhanced yield profile.

The ETF’s underlying focus is the global semiconductor industry, which includes companies involved in the design, manufacture, and supply of chips and related technologies used in computing, communications, consumer electronics, automotive systems, and industrial applications.
